Recently U.Kohlenbach proved general metatheorems for the extraction of (uniform) bounds from classical proofs in functional analysis. The proof was based on a combination of Gödel's functional interpretation and Bezem's strong majorization relation. We present a generalization of the majorization relation which allows to generalize Kohlenbach's metatheorems significantly. Finally, we will discuss some examples which are now covered by the new metatheorems.
